Grounding

TO PREVENT ELECTRIC SHOCK AND DEATH FROM INCORRECT GROUNDING:

Check with a qualified electrician if you are in doubt as to whether the outlet is properly grounded. 
Do not modify the power cord plug provided with the charger. Do not use the charger if the 
power cord or plug is damaged. If damaged, have it repaired by a service facility before use. If 
the plug will not fit the outlet, have a proper outlet installed by a qualified electrician.

Extension Cords

  Extension cords must not be used with this item’s Charger.
